WebSimilar to adult performance, 41 the MCTSIB total score was reliable. The sensitivity, specificity, and predictive values were 78% or greater for a cutoff score of 110 total seconds. However, if only doing condition 4 of the MCTSIB, test-retest reliability decreased (ICC = 0.56). Therefore, we recommend that all conditions of the MCTSIB be ... Web20 mei 2013 · Key Descriptions. The CTSIB-M is a modification of the CTSIB that eliminates the use of the visual conflict dome (Cohen et al 1993). It includes conditions 1,2,4,and 5 of the original CTSIB. To perform the test the patient stands … Professional Association Recommendation. WebThe i-mCTSIB measurements utilizing the VSR Sport demonstrated good-to-excellent test-retest reliability. The clinical relevance of this study is that it demonstrates that the VSR Sport is a feasible alternative to other more expensive computerized systems used for the assessment of postural sway.
